Marquette priest on administrative leave after sexual misconduct complaint

A Catholic priest in the Marquette diocese is on administrative leave after a recent allegation of sexual misconduct.

The diocese says Father Frank M. Lenz has been removed from public ministry as a precautionary measure while the allegation is investigated. The diocese says the complaint was reported to the Marquette County Prosecutor’s office, which did not immediately return a request for comment.

A diocese press release calls the allegation a "credible complaint" alleging sexual misconduct by Lenz with a minor dating back to the 1970s. Lenz denies the allegation.

Lenz has been removed from public ministry and is prohibited from "presenting himself as a priest" according to the same press release. 

A spokesperson for the diocese said he did not have any further details about the complaint.

The diocese says it has “extended an offer of pastoral care to the person bringing the allegation.”

Diocese of Marquette Bishop John Doerfler apologized in a statement to “all victims of clergy abuse.”

The rotary club of Marquette has Lenz listed as its president on its website.
